D17 Engine
 
Does anyone know if the new Engines (D17) in the 7th gen civics have interchangeable heads? Like to put a Ex head on a Dx Block.
Thanks in advance for the help.

armyguy5 01-09-2003 06:41 PM

no because of V-TEC and there different enige codes a ex is a D17A2 i think the dx is D17A6

chris

slowEJ6 01-09-2003 09:20 PM

that wouldnt matter.

you can put a D16Y8 or D16Y5 vtec head on a D16Y7 non vtec block. you can put a B16A vtec head on a B18B non vtec block. how else do you think you build a crvtec or lsvtec motor?!?!

im sure it can be done, i dunno whats necessary to make it work though and the gains you would get will probably not even be worth how much you spend.
